Subject: Orkimedes' kustom gubbinz and Gifts of Gork and Mork
|
 |
Ancient Ultramarine Venerable Dreadnought
|
The rules for both go as follows:
Orkimedes' kustom gubbinz: Only one can be taken per army
Gifts of Gork and Mork: Only one can be taken per army.
My question is: Can we take both a kustom gubbin and a Gift of Gork and Mork in one army, or can we take only one or the other?

Read the 'Forces of Da Great Waaagh!' page, before the 'Orkimedes' Kustom Gubbinz' page:
"Any units from a Detachment or Formation presented in this book that can select Gifts of Gork and Mork cannot select from those listed in Codex: Orks, but can instead select from Orkimedes’ Kustom Gubbinz, presented opposite, at the points costs shown."
So you may only take from one list or the other as determined by which book you follow for each detachment, but if you have detachments from both books then each detachment may take one of each (up to one of each per army, i.e. all detachments) from its corresponding list.
